In this role, you will perform a Marketing Pricing analyst role implementing and communicating trade policy & objectives through day to day activities for Trans Atlantic Westbound Trade (TA WB). You will also coordinate & manage Europe Export vessel space management in line with Transatlantic West Bound Trade policy & objectives.
The Role
* To act as Marketing Pricing Focal Point for designated region(s) whilst demonstrating a sound awareness of the regional commodities/markets and operational infrastructure.
* The role is exclusively dealing with the Trans Atlantic Trade and therefore relevant experience in this trade is desirable.
* To perform regular structural review of regions performance against target levels & follow-up on any performance deviations.
* To work with aforementioned regions and monitor any deviations in performance.
* To be fully proficient with US FMC filing and regulatory requirements.
* Responding to rate requests in a timely fashion (within 24hrs) whilst analysing & judging business contribution in the context of current / prospected market conditions as well as Trade / region performance.
* Completing timely and accurate tender submissions demonstrating commercial awareness & sound pricing in the process.
* Complete regular KPI reports and follow up on any deviations.
* To represent the Marketing Trade team at internal & external meetings as & when required.
* To be fully proficient with all Trade Management related Opus Modules and perform timely and accurate data review. Support in the maintenance of Opus data as & when required.
* To act as the Focal Point for Space management on designated region(s) / Service(s) whilst demonstrating a sound awareness of the regional commodities/markets and operational infrastructure.
* Responsible for Laden and Empty space management ensuring that Trans Atlantic Trade achieves same in/out equipment flow and/or 100% slot utilisation on vessels as per Trade policy and in close co-ordination with Container Flow management & Yield teams.
* Prepare daily reports which facilitate the process management & optimisation of vessel allocations. For example, submit a Container Booking Forecast (CBF) to the Ship Operator.
* Co-ordinate implementation of Customer Allocation/Account Plan process and undertake performance management thereof.
